AI Development Accelerator

Developers spend more time on operational and background tasks than they do on coding, according to an IDC analyst report from Feb 2025.

The AI Development Accelerator attacks this productivity drain by embedding intelligence at every stage of the SDLC. The platform ingests raw meeting transcripts and automatically generates structured user stories, developer-ready prompts, and comprehensive test cases.

It integrates seamlessly with Azure DevOps and GitHub and eliminates the manual translation work that typically spans hours, days or weeks.

Our early prototypes processed 25-minute meetings into fully structured stories with acceptance criteria, generated contextual prompts for developers, and produced complete test case suites in just a few clicks, all without human intervention.


AI Use: Why Intelligence Matters

Software development suffers from a fundamental translation problem: business requirements expressed in meetings must be manually converted into technical specifications, then into code, then into tests.

Each handoff introduces delays, inconsistencies, and information loss.

AI doesn't simply have the ability to speed up these translations, it can eliminate the translation layer entirely.

Large language models can parse unstructured conversation, extract intent, generate technical specifications in consistent formats, and produce contextually relevant code scaffolding.

This isn't automation of existing processes; it's the removal of entire categories of manual work that exist purely because humans needed intermediary steps to move from business language to technical execution.
